						<section><p>Proceedings under this chapter may be instituted upon <span class="dictionary">petition</span>, verified by <span class="dictionary">oath</span> or affirmation, filed by a child, a parent, a person claiming parentage, a person standing in loco parentis to the child or having legal <span class="dictionary">custody</span> of the child or a representative of the Department of Social Services or the Department of Juvenile Justice.
		The child may be made a <span class="dictionary">party</span> to the action, and if he is a <span class="dictionary">minor</span> and is made a <span class="dictionary">party</span>, he shall be represented by a <span class="dictionary">guardian ad litem</span> appointed by the <span class="dictionary">court</span> in accordance with the procedures specified in &#xA7;&#xA0;<a class="law" title="Appointment of counsel and guardian ad litem" href="/16.1-266/">16.1-266</a> or &#xA7;&#xA0;<a class="law" title="Guardian ad litem for persons under disability; when guardian ad litem need not be appointed for person under disability" href="/8.01-9/">8.01-9</a>. The child&#x2019;s mother or father may not represent the child as guardian or otherwise. The determination of the <span class="dictionary">court</span> under the provisions of this chapter shall not be binding on any person who is not a <span class="dictionary">party</span>.
		The <span class="dictionary">circuit</span> <span class="dictionary">courts</span> shall have concurrent <span class="dictionary">original jurisdiction</span> of cases arising under this chapter with the juvenile and domestic relations district <span class="dictionary">courts</span> when the parentage of a child is at <span class="dictionary">issue</span> in any matter otherwise before the <span class="dictionary">circuit</span> <span class="dictionary">court</span>. The determination of parentage, when raised in any proceeding, shall be governed by this chapter.</p></section></text><history>1988, cc. 866, 878; 1989, c. 368; 2008, cc. 164, 201.</history><metadata></metadata></law>
